After installation and restart, Magnolia is unusable - both author and public instance display login screen, but user is unable to log in, and there is following message in the log: ERROR info.magnolia.cms.security.SystemUserManager : Failed to login as anonymous user The situation is the same even without restart if magnolia.update.auto is set to true. |

SystemUserManager.getRequiredSystemUser() is likely the culprit. It needs to refresh and retry after getting ItemNotFoundException instead of failing immediately. |
